Jewish settler leaders prayed on Monday for US President Donald Trump's re-election during a ceremony at the Cave of the Patriarchs in Hebron.

"We have come to bless President Trump, both for the past, to thank him, but also for the future, that he succeeds in the coming election," Yishai Fleisher, spokesman for the Hebron settlers, said.
One of the biblical forefathers interred at the site according to tradition, is Abraham, who is revered by Jews, Christians and Muslims. Hoping to encourage coexistence between Jews and Palestinians, the Trump administration has named the Israeli-Arab rapprochement that it has been brokering the "Abraham Accords."
